Arduino Mini 05 (no headers) The Arduino Mini is a small microcontroller board originally based on the ATmega168, but now supplied with the 328, intended for use on breadboards and when space is at a premium. It has 14 digital input/output pins (of which 6 can be used as PWM outputs), 8 analog inputs, and a 16 MHz crystal oscillator. It can be programmed with the USB Serial adapter or other USB or RS232 to TTL serial adapter. The new Mini (revision 05) has a new package for the ATmega328, which enables all components to be on the top of the board. It also has an onboard reset button. The new version has the same pin configuration as revision 04. Warning: Don't power the Arduino mini with more than 9 volts, or plug the power in backwards: you'll probably kill it. Technical Specifications Microcontroller ATmega328 Operating Voltage 5V Input Voltage 7-9 V Digital I/O Pins 14 (of which 6 provide PWM output) Analog Input Pins 8 (of which 4 are broken out onto pins) DC Current per I/O Pin 40 mA Flash Memory 32 KB (of which 2 KB used by boot loader) SRAM 2 KB EEPROM 1 KB Clock Speed 16 MHz
